Surface Modelling with Impact Design’s Russell Mapplebeck

After some great surface modelling by Russell at Impact Design Pty Ltd, the Oryol P2S10 Formula Ford took its final form today.  

Russell is one of the best surface modellers around with a lifetimes experience in the discipline, he utilises all the latest and most advanced modelling software available in todays advanced manufacturing environment; we were very lucky to have found Russell and are so glad we did. 

We now have some great rendered pictures depicting just how good the new car should look.  (These are not artistically rendered conceptual drawings, but are actual rendered Computer Aided Design drawings)   

The final look and feel of the car is a combination of aerodynamic CFD analysis and F1 inspired design.  These features combined with G3 continuity of shape and flow give us the fantastic shape we now can see.   

The results show a marked improvement not only in aerodynamics but also in looks against other modern-day Formula Fords.   

There is no doubt that the Oryol P2S10 Formula Ford is going to reinvigorate the look and feel, of Formula Fords, to that of other modern formula racecar designs.
